The Interest Group is the new project of Philadelphia’s bonkers Yohsuke Araki (BAnanas Symphony, Blackhawks) and to call their new single, “The Passenger,” gorgeous would probably still be underselling it by miles. Both this track and “The Boy and The Girls” (the other of two singles on their bandcamp page at the moment) would fit quite nicely between some Margo Guryan and The Free Design, I’d say.
